The 2011 Arts Patron of the Year Award will be presented to Russell Simmons and Danny Simmons, co-Founders, Rush Philanthopic for the Arts.

Russell and Danny Simmons
 

USA Today named Russell Simmons one of the Top 25 Most influential People of the Past 25 years, calling him a, “hip-hop pioneer” for his groundbreaking vision that has influenced music, fashion, finance, television and film, as well as the face of modern philanthropy. 

Danny Simmons is a poet, abstract artist, author and art collector. The consummate Brooklyn mover and shaker serves on the boards of the Brooklyn Museum of Art and Brooklyn Academy of Music, and is a member of the New York State Council on the Arts.

The Rush Philanthropic Arts Foundation, founded in 1995 by brothers the Simmons brothers Russell, Danny and Joseph “Rev. Run”, is dedicated to providing disadvantaged youth with access to the arts, and offering exhibition opportunities from underrepresented artists and artists of color. Over the past 15 years, the team has developed a broad base of friends, collaborators and supporters dedicated to supporting its mission.  The Foundation serves 2,000 students annually.
